Inspection Frequency and Scheduling

Industry guidelines, such as those from the National Fire Protection Association (NFPA), recommend monthly visual inspections and annual comprehensive testing of exit signs and emergency lighting systems. However, facilities with heavy foot traffic may benefit from increased inspection frequency, especially during peak usage periods or seasonal events that draw larger crowds. Establishing a detailed inspection schedule tailored to the facility’s operational dynamics ensures consistent monitoring and maintenance.

Key Components to Inspect

  • Illumination: Confirm that exit signs are brightly lit and visible from all required viewing distances. Dim or flickering lights should be addressed immediately.
  • Obstruction Checks: Ensure that signs are not blocked by temporary structures, decorations, or stored materials that could obscure visibility during an emergency.
  • Physical Condition: Look for cracks, dents, fading, graffiti, or other forms of physical damage that may impair the sign’s effectiveness.
  • Battery Backup Systems: Test internal batteries or backup power supplies to verify they can sustain illumination during power outages, as required by code.
  • Mounting and Positioning: Confirm that signs are securely mounted and correctly positioned according to architectural and safety requirements.

Common Maintenance Tasks

  • Replacing Burned-Out Bulbs and LEDs: Use manufacturer-approved replacement parts to maintain consistent illumination quality and reliability.
  • Battery Replacement: Regularly swap out backup batteries according to manufacturer guidelines or sooner if battery tests indicate diminished capacity.
  • Cleaning: Remove dust, dirt, or grime from sign surfaces and lenses to maximize light output and visibility.
  • Electrical Component Checks: Inspect wiring, connectors, and circuit boards for signs of wear, corrosion, or damage.
  • Structural Repairs: Fix or replace mounting brackets and sign enclosures that are loose, damaged, or insecure.

Testing Backup Power Systems

Battery backup systems are vital for maintaining exit sign illumination during power outages. Conduct monthly functional tests by simulating power failures to ensure that backup batteries activate and sustain proper lighting duration, typically a minimum of 90 minutes. Any deficiencies should prompt immediate battery replacement or system repair.

Compliance With Safety Codes and Standards

Adherence to regulatory requirements is not only a legal obligation but also a key factor in ensuring occupant safety. Several codes and standards govern exit sign installation and maintenance, including:

  • National Fire Protection Association (NFPA) 101 - Life Safety Code: Specifies requirements for exit sign visibility, illumination, and backup power in various occupancy types.
  • Occupational Safety and Health Administration (OSHA): Mandates proper exit route markings and maintenance in workplaces.
  • International Building Code (IBC): Provides standards on exit signage placement and functionality.
  • Local Fire and Building Codes: May impose additional or more stringent requirements specific to jurisdictions.

Regular audits by certified safety professionals can verify compliance and identify areas for improvement. Keeping thorough maintenance logs, inspection reports, and repair records is essential for demonstrating conformity during inspections and mitigating liability in the event of incidents.

Advanced Technologies and Innovations in Exit Sign Maintenance

Emerging technologies are enhancing exit sign reliability and simplifying maintenance tasks, particularly in complex, high-traffic environments.

LED Lighting

Modern exit signs increasingly utilize LED technology, which offers longer lifespans, lower energy consumption, and improved brightness compared to traditional incandescent bulbs. LEDs reduce maintenance frequency and contribute to sustainability goals.

Self-Diagnostic Systems

Some advanced exit signs feature built-in self-testing and diagnostic capabilities that automatically monitor illumination and battery status. These systems can alert facility managers via digital notifications when maintenance is required, enabling more efficient upkeep.

Integration With Building Management Systems (BMS)

Integrating exit signs into a BMS allows centralized monitoring of multiple safety components, including emergency lighting and fire alarm systems. This integration facilitates real-time status updates, streamlined inspections, and coordinated emergency responses.
